  • Intel agrees to sell a 10% stake to the US, valued at $10 billion.
  • Deal finalized after talks between Trump and Intel CEO Lip-Bu Tan.
  • Trump previously accused Tan of ties to the Chinese Communist Party.
  •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ick proposed US stakes in chipmakers for CHIPS Act funding access.
  • Senator Bernie Sanders supports the plan for taxpayer returns on investments.
  • US likely to target chipmakers not increasing US investments, excluding companies like TSMC.
